Clever people with no morals use that to load ads under your finger, timed to create an inadvertent click.

I swear NYT do this in their games app, the play button gets replaced with a subscribe as the late loaded subscribe element shifts the page exactly the amount to put subscribe under your finger. I wonder how well it worked?

Nothing clever about it: it’s a simple and unethical parlour trick.

Every news website does it and, in the UK, the local news outlets are amongst the worst.

The thing I don’t get: many of these sites are running Google Adsense, amongst other ad networks. Adsense Ts & Cs specifically forbid site behaviour that deliberately causes users to misclick on ads.

So why aren’t these sites being banned by Adsense?

The answer, I suspect, is follow the money: it seems likely that they bring in too much money for Google to ban them even though they’re overtly and outrageously breaking the rules.
